It is worth the trip. They ask that you call at least a day ahead.

There were about 10 frames of various types completed or in process and the frames and suspensions are impressive. The Cummins 2.8 was an interesting alternative. They will be at the Super Celebration East in October. Kincer did a lot of the work on the Leno Bronco, I can see why. For one example, the gas tank is a work of art !!
